Welspun Middle East

Welspun Middle East started its operation in 2010 when Welspun Corp Ltd. acquired interest in Aziz European Pipe Factory. The facility is situated at Dammam Industrial City in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, about 40 kms from AL Khobar towards Hofuf. This is one of the largest spiral pipe manufacturing facilities in the area. The state-of-the-art mill was set up in 2006 and can produce up to 350,000 MTPA of spiral pipes. It also has a coating plant of 1mn sq. mt per annum capacity. 

Welspun Middle East has modern and sophisticated manufacturing equipments with latest art lab testing facilities. The pipe division is capable of manufacture pipes up to X80 Grade as per API/EN/ASTM/ISO and other specifications. It has the capacity to produce the pipe length up to 18.00 meters. 

Welspun Corp Ltd. (WCL), the flagship company of Welspun Group, which Welspun Middle East is a part of, is today one of the Largest Large Diameter Line Pipe Company in the World. It is ranked as the 2nd Largest (Large Diameter) Pipe Producer by Financial Times UK and awarded 'The ‘Emerging Company of the Year' by Economic Times, 2008, respectively. With a strong culture of ‘Engineering Excellence' WCL takes pride in manufacturing and supplying some of the most critical pipelines in the World from its Indian and U.S. plants with an installed pipe line capacity of nearly 2.0 MTPA. 

To its credit, the company has supplied pipes for World’s deepest pipeline project (Independence Trail', Gulf of Mexico), Highest Pipeline project (Peru LNG), to the longest pipeline (Canada to US) and the heaviest Pipeline (Persian Gulf). WCL’s has an esteemed client list which includes TransCanada, Enterprise, Kinder Morgan, Texas Gas, Hunt Oil, Saudi Aramco, Elpaso, Exxon Mobil and Qatar Petro DOW to name a few.
